I am far from a populist.  I am Reagan Republican.  However, you knew you would see this coming with the banks.

When working a short sale, I ensure the bank puts the non-recourse in writing, or make sure the clients document I advised them to seek a lawyer's opinion about the potential risks of recourse (or that they willingly chose not to).

Well, here comes the first of the deficiency judgments...
